After working for 20 years at big cosmetic companies, Skinn's founder, Dmitri James was really frustrated. This, in his own words, is pretty interesting...
When I launched Skinn in 2002 the question most asked was "How are you going to do it Dimitri? How are you going to give us more products, better products, and keep them at a comparable price?" The answer was really quite simple. After working at the highest levels of the big cosmetics houses, I learned that the money they spend does not go into the product. In fact, it seems to go everywhere but the product: ad campaigns, department store counter space, Park Avenue offices, and, most of all, packaging. Believe it or not, most companies spend more money on the container and fancy boxes than on the product that's inside. I used to sit in meetings in those Park Avenue offices to talk about how to improve the company's products. Those meetings always seem to end the same: "Let's change the packaging." Upgrading the product was always deemed too costly as it would require re-educating the consumer about what constitutes a quality product. In essence the secret would be out that water does not have to be the first ingredient in every product.
